Why These Are the Top Acura Repair Auto Repair Shops in Nickerson

** The Acura repair market for Nickerson residents is entirely dependent on the larger hub of Hutchinson, KS. The level of competition is moderate, with a handful of shops capable of servicing Acuras, but only one or two (notably M&R Imports) that can be considered true "specialists." There are no Acura-exclusive performance tuners in the immediate area. **Average Quality:** The quality of service is generally good to very good for routine maintenance and common repairs. For highly specialized work (e.g., complex SH-AWD diagnostics, performance ECU tuning), owners may need to travel to Wichita (50 miles away), which hosts several dedicated import performance shops and the official Acura dealership. **Competition Level:** Low to Moderate within the direct service area (Hutchinson). The primary competition is between a few reputable independent shops and the service departments of larger dealerships (like Mel Hambleton) that have the necessary equipment.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ive and typically 20-30% lower than dealership labor rates in Wichita. Independent shops like M&R Imports offer significant savings while still providing expert-level service. Expect to pay $110-$140 per hour for labor at a high-quality independent shop in Hutchinson, compared to $150+ at a Wichita dealership.

Where in Nickerson or nearby can I find a mechanic qualified to work on my Acura?

Nickerson itself has limited specialized dealerships, so residents typically rely on trusted independent shops in Hutchinson or Sterling. Look for a shop with certified technicians, especially those with experience in Honda/Acura vehicles, and ask specifically about their diagnostic tools for modern Acura systems.

Are Acura repair costs higher in Nickerson compared to larger cities like Wichita?

Labor rates in Nickerson and surrounding Reno County can be slightly lower than in major metropolitan areas. However, the cost for genuine Acura parts is generally consistent, and the convenience of a local, trusted shop often outweighs the drive to a Wichita dealership for many owners.

What are the most common Acura repair issues for drivers in the Nickerson climate?

Given Kansas temperature extremes, the Acura's battery, climate control system (especially AC compressors), and engine cooling system are under significant stress. Additionally, suspension components can wear from rough rural roads and potholes common in the area.

When should I seek local service for my Acura's warning lights instead of driving to a dealer?

For critical warnings like overheating or oil pressure, stop immediately and call for a tow to the nearest qualified shop. For less urgent lights, a reputable local mechanic in Hutchinson can perform a diagnostic scan to identify the issue, often saving you a trip if it's a minor sensor fault.

How can I ensure quality Acura service from a local shop?

Seek shops that use high-quality or OEM parts and provide detailed estimates. In Nickerson's community, personal referrals are invaluable, so ask neighbors or check local reviews for shops known for honesty and expertise with Japanese luxury vehicles.
